Abstract
The utility model discloses a kind of distributed scheduling automatic test platforms,Including platform body,Studdle is equipped at left and right sides of the platform body lower end,And the studdle is fixedly connected with platform body,Automation cabinet is equipped among the platform body lower end,And the automation cabinet connects with platform body,Downside interlocking has ventilation exhaust outlet in the automation cabinet front end,Upside is fixed with cabinet state display in the automation cabinet front end,Kind distributed scheduling automatic test platform,Automation is taken to operate,But also a variety of test jobs can be operated,Platform body is wired to by automating cabinet connection,Control test experiments of the test pressure machine test reaction tank with vacuum seal container,Pressure testing machine can also be by testing the pressure duty details inside film viewing screen observation,It can be run by testing and control display screen with the various test jobs in control platform.
